Excessive Idling

Fmb120 excessive idling.png

When vehicle stops for a specific amount of time a scenario is activated, a record will be generated and digital output status will be changed to 1 (if configured). You can configure the time it takes to turn on this scenario (Time to Stopped). Scenario is activated until the vehicle starts moving and keeps moving (movement is detected only by the accelerometer) for an amount of time that is configured. You can configure the time it takes to turn OFF this scenario (Time to Stopped).














Unplug Detection

An eventual event will be generated when FMB120 is unplugged from external power or plugged back again. User can select the detection type: Simple, which is used in cars, where power voltage is not dependant on ignition (recommended); Advanced, which is used in cars, where power voltage is disconnected when ignition is switched off.









Bw nb.png In Unplug Detection and Towing Detection scenarios if Eventual Records is enabled and event will be generated (included into the sent records) only when scenario starts and finishes. If Eventual Records is disabled scenario status value is sent in each AVL record.

Towing Detection

Towing Detection feature helps to inform the driver about car deporting. FMB120 generates an event when car is being towed or lifted, for example in case of vehicle evacuation.
















Crash Detection

If Crash Detection is enabled, it monitors acceleration on each axis, which helps to detect an accident.
If Crash Trace is disabled a crash detection event will be generated (included into the sent record) only when scenario starts and finishes.
If Crash Trace is enabled FMB120 will collect acceleration data every 40 msec. Buffer is big enough to hold data for 5 seconds and on Crash Event detection, records will be generated from this buffer, following from these conditions:

  • Every second Acceleration changed more than 50mG data will be collected and records will be generated 5 seconds after the event using the same conditions.
  • Every generated record will have accelerometer X Y Z values included.
  • Each record will have accurate timestamps in milliseconds.
